New Delhi: Superstar Shah Rukh Khan and filmmaker Karan Johar will host the International Indian Film Festival (IIFA) 2024 at Yas Island in Abu Dhabi. The awards ceremony is scheduled for September 28.
IIFA 2024 will be a three-day star-studded event 27 September To 29 September. The following events will take place on the first day, September 27 IIFA Utsavam; The second day, September 28, will be IIFA Awards; and will be performed on the last day, September 29 IIFA Rocks,
Shahid Kapoor is also all set to rock the stage with his performance in this star-studded series.
Shah Rukh Khan shared his thoughts with ANI about hosting the 24th edition of the IIFA Festival. He said, “IIFA is a celebration of Indian cinema that resonates across the world and it has been amazing to be a part of its journey over the years. I am looking forward to bringing alive the energy, passion and grandeur of IIFA once again as we gear up for an unforgettable celebration of Indian cinema this September.”
Following this, filmmaker Karan Johar also shared his excitement and deep personal connection with IIFA with ANI, saying, “For over two decades, IIFA has been an important part of my journey. My father, with his extensive industry experience and vision, was a key member of IIFA’s advisory board in its early years, contributing to its mission to celebrate Indian cinema.”
“His association with IIFA was a matter of immense pride, further cementing our family’s deep bond with the Indian film industry and its international reach. It is an absolute honour to rekindle the magic for an unprecedented third showcase on the iconic IIFA stage on September 27-29 with my dear friend Shah Rukh Khan,” Johar added.
This eagerly-awaited event will celebrate the best achievements of Indian cinema. The jury will comprise of industry stalwarts, critics and film experts who will thoroughly evaluate the cinematic achievements of the year.
